With the development of computer, embedded system has become an important part of computer science and researching focus. Porting embedded OS and developing driver are popular now and there has lots of job at the real industry area. Porting ARMLinux and writing drivers based on S3CEB2410 board is studied in this paper. ARM926T is an efficient low-power RISC core.
S3C2410, which is based on this core and integrated with many devices, is suitable in embedded system. We choose ARMLinux as embedded operation system, S3CEB2410 as software development board. This article describes the porting procedure of ARMLinux to S3CEB2410 and the procedure of device driver development.There are six parts combined into embedded OS development: hardware platform, tool and develop environment, BSP develop , embedded OS modification, driver coding and integration and application realization. This paper describes all parts of process except application realization.Also, using emulating USB network card instead of COM port and network card is well introduced as one of the most important features in this paper...
- Linux 4.12 Release – Main Changes, ARM & MIPS Architectures
- ODROID-C2 Board Gets Experimental Ubuntu 16.04 Armbian Images with Linux 4.10
- NVIDIA Tegra186/Parker/TX2 Support For Linux 4.12
- Canonical Developer Works on Bringing Snap Support to Raspberry Pi's Raspbian
- Linux Kernel 3.18.51 Released with MIPS, ARM, and CIFS Changes, Updated Drivers
- LibreELEC-Based Lakka 2.0 Officially Released with Raspberry Pi Zero W Support